Intro

MOTi delivers the quintessential sound of the modern festival mainstage. His music is defined by a relentless forward momentum, characterized by thick, sawtooth synth leads and heavy, sidechained basslines that demand physical movement. It is high-definition electronic music where every kick drum is engineered for maximum impact and every build-up is a masterclass in tension and release.

What sets him apart is his ability to bridge the gap between aggressive electro house and melodic accessibility. While many of his peers lean into pure noise, MOTi maintains a sense of groove and pop-sensibility, often utilizing clever vocal chops and bright, shimmering textures that cut through the mix. His collaborations with heavyweights like Tiësto and Martin Garrix showcase a versatility that ranges from dark club weapons to radio-ready anthems.

Timotheus "Timo" Romme (born 23 March 1987), better known by his stage name Moti (stylized as MOTi), is a Dutch electro house DJ and music producer from Amsterdam. MOTi's first release was "Circuits" in 2012, which was published on Afrojack's Wall Recordings. By the end 2012, MOTi had been commissioned for official remixes of Flo Rida, Tiësto and Far East Movement. MOTi frequently releases singles on Spinnin Records and Tiësto's Musical Freedom label; he has collaborated with artists such as Tiësto, Major Lazer and Dzeko & Torres. His 2014 collaboration with Martin Garrix, "Virus (How About Now)", reached No. 27 on the Dutch Single Top 100. Frequently on tour, MOTi has performed at major festivals such as the Amsterdam Dance Event, Creamfields UK, Nocturnal Wonderland and Tomorrowland.
